Exploring the Wizarding World’s Intrigues
The literary phenomenon of the Harry Potter series reaches new heights with J.K. Rowling’s third masterpiece, “Harry Potter and the Prisoner of Azkaban.” It invites readers into a deepening narrative filled with dark undertones and compelling character arcs.
Sirius Black: The Fugitive Wizard
“Prisoner of Azkaban” throws us into the tumultuous pursuit of Sirius Black, an alleged follower of the nefarious Lord Voldemort. Black’s escape from Azkaban prison brings unease across the magical community and poses unforeseen consequences for Harry.
Dementors: The Face of Despair
In this spellbinding entry, we meet the Dementors, ghastly beings that evoke terror at Hogwarts. Their chilling presence serves as a metaphor for the darkness lurking within and around us, a theme Rowling illustrates with haunting clarity.
Unraveling the Marauder’s Map
The Marauder’s Map emerges as a significant element, showcasing Rowling’s flair for merging imaginative concepts with character backstories, further enriching the wizarding lore.
A Twist in Time: The Time-Turner
The introduction of time travel via the Time-Turner adds a sophisticated layer to the plot, questioning the moral complexities of temporal interference while maintaining an enthralling pace.

Character Evolution and the Strength of Friendship
The story’s heart lies in the evolving dynamics between Harry, Ron, and Hermione. The arrival of Remus Lupin contributes another nuanced thread to this rich tapestry of relationships.
Quidditch: Beyond the Game
Quidditch sequences reflect the overarching narrative of unity against shared challenges, symbolizing the complex interplay of collaboration and competition inherent in the Hogwarts ethos.
The Patronus Charm: Embracing Hope
The revered Patronus Charm is introduced, a testament to the enduring human spirit and our capacity to confront the bleakest moments with hope and resilience.
Culmination: The Series Comes of Age
With “The Prisoner of Azkaban,” Rowling sets the stage for the series’ future turmoil. The book stands out for its blend of enigma and maturation, ensuring Harry Potter’s legacy continues to cast a spell over new fans.
